grub-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[PATCH v2 0/5] Enable Automatic Disk Unlock with TPM2 on ieee1275


From: Stefan Berger
Subject: [PATCH v2 0/5] Enable Automatic Disk Unlock with TPM2 on ieee1275
Date: Mon, 25 Nov 2024 17:41:37 -0500

This series of patches enables the 'Automatic Disk Unlock with TPM2'
support for ieee1275 PowerPC platforms. It adds a TCG2 driver for this
platform, which has the same API as the one for EFI. Further, it adjusts
the definition of TPM 2 related bit fields for big endian targets.

Regards,
   Stefan

v2:
 - Applied Gary's R-b tag to 1/5
 - Split v1 2/2 into 4 patches
 - Refactoring of grub_ieee1275_tpm_init 

Stefan Berger (5):
  tss2: Adjust bit fields for big endian targets
  ieee1275/ibmvtpm: Move initializaton functions to TCG2 driver
  ieee1275/tcg2: Refactor grub_ieee1275_tpm_init
  ieee1275/tcg2: Add TCG2 driver for ieee1275 PowerPC firmware
  tpm2_key_protector: Enable build for powerpc_ieee1275

 grub-core/Makefile.core.def           |   3 +
 grub-core/commands/ieee1275/ibmvtpm.c |  46 +-------
 grub-core/lib/ieee1275/tcg2.c         | 156 ++++++++++++++++++++++++++
 grub-core/lib/tss2/tss2_structs.h     |  38 +++++++
 include/grub/ieee1275/tpm.h           |  32 ++++++
 5 files changed, 233 insertions(+), 42 deletions(-)
 create mode 100644 grub-core/lib/ieee1275/tcg2.c
 create mode 100644 include/grub/ieee1275/tpm.h

-- 
2.25.1




reply via email to

[Prev in Thread] Current Thread [Next in Thread]